EE.3.OA.1-2
Use repeated addition to find the total number of objects and determine the sum.
EE.3.OA.4
Solve addition and subtraction problems when result is unknown, limited to operands and results within 20.
EE.3.OA.8
Solve one-step real-world problems using addition or subtraction within 20.
EE.3.OA.9
Identify arithmetic patterns.
EE.3.NBT.1
Use decade numbers (10, 20, 30) as benchmarks to demonstrate understanding of place value for numbers 0–30.
EE.3.NBT.2
Demonstrate understanding of place value to tens.
EE.3.NBT.3
Count by tens using models such as objects, base ten blocks, or money.
EE.3.NF.1–3
Differentiate a fractional part from a whole.
EE.3.MD.1
Tell time to the hour on a digital clock.
EE.3.MD.2
Identify the appropriate measurement tool to solve one-step word problems involving mass and volume.
EE.3.MD.3
Use picture or bar graph data to answer questions about data.
EE.3.MD.4
Measure length of objects using standard tools, such as rulers, yardsticks, and meter sticks.
EE.3.G.1
Describe attributes of two-dimensional shapes.
EE.3.G.2
Recognize that shapes can be partitioned into equal areas.
